This painting, entitled Sunflowers, was completed for Jim and Joann Rich, owners of The Huntingfield Creek Inn -a lovely bed and breakfast just outside of the Eastern Neck Wildlife Refuge. The Refuge is part of the Northeast Region U.S. Fish & Wildlife Service. The original painting is 8" x 10" and Highlights the breathtaking sunflowers that adorn the Inn's side lawn every summer. The grounds of the Inn feature 6' zinnias, a large lavender garden, and access to the lovely Chesapeake Bay.
